File an appeal?
Decisions of the Planning Commission and the Design Review Board (DRB) can be appealed to the City Council. Appeals must be filed within 10 days following the Planning Commission or DRB rendering their decision. If the 10th day is on a weekend, the appeal must be filed by 5:00 p.m. on Monday, the first business day following the weekend. If the Monday following the weekend is a holiday, then the appeal must by filed by 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day.

A filing fee of $150 must be paid at the time the appeal is filed. If the fee is not paid at the time the appeal is filed, the appeal is returned to the appellant with instruction that the appeal is not considered filed until the fee is paid.

Public Hearing for appeals must be scheduled and heard within 30 days after the appeal is filed. The Clerk selects the date of the hearing and sends a letter to the appellant informing him/her of the date of the hearing and the hearing procedures.[Online Fillable Form]
